Nguyên Lý Led Thu Phát Hồng Ngoại

Mục Tiêu yêu thương cầu

Đề tài này áp dụng một cặp IC thu (PT2249) phân phát (PT2248) kết phù hợp với vi điều khiển 89S52 để chế tạo ra thành mạch điều khiển, định thời. IC phát (PT2248) có nhiệm vụ kiểm tra phím được nhấn cùng truyền mã phím kia đi bên dưới dạng xung thông qua led vạc hồng ngoại. IC thu (PT2249) có trách nhiệm kiểm tra biểu hiện nhận được và biến hóa mức logic của những ngõ ra theo xung dìm được. Biểu hiện ngõ ra của IC thu được đưa tới vi cách xử trí và ban đầu giải mã biểu thị này theo lịch trình được viết sẵn.

Bạn đang xem: Nguyên lý led thu phát hồng ngoại

Từ đây hoàn toàn có thể suy ra mục tiêu yêu mong của chủ đề như sau:

 Có thể điều khiển thiết bị từ bỏ xa trải qua cặp IC thu phát. Có thể thiết lập thời gian, khởi cồn hoặc giới hạn thiết bị bởi 6 phím nhấn. Khi thời gian cài cặt đã mất sẽ tự động hóa ngắt mối cung cấp thiết bị. Giá thành sản phẩm không thật đắt. Chạy ổn định định, thiết yếu xác, bé dại gọn, dễ sử dựng, sửa chữa.

2. Linh Kiện chủ yếu Sử Dụng vào Mạch

IC Phát bộc lộ Hồng ngoại PT2248IC Thu và Mã Hóa tín hiệu Hồng ngoại PT2249Module giỏi LED Thu biểu đạt Hầng nước ngoài PIC – 1018SCLLed quang quẻ – LED Phát dấu hiệu Hồng NgoạiVi Điều Khiển AT89S52Relay

3. Sơ Đồ Nguyên Lý• Sơ đồ vật mạch phátThạch anh xấp xỉ cùa PT2248 là thạch anh dao động có tần số 455Khz

*

Khi một phím trên bàn phím được nhấn (VD phím số 1), thì chân 10 (Tl) cùng chân (Kl) thông mạch cùng nhau ( những chân Tl, KI bên trên IC PT2248), bây giờ ra của IC PT2248 bên trên chân 15 (Txout) sẽ phát tiếp tục một chuỗi xung điện bước vào cực B của transistor q.2 (AI013) kích dẫn transistor q.1 (D468) (hai transistor này mắc darỉỉngton bù nhằm mục đích tăng cái cho led phát hồng ngoại, giúp led phát mạnh mẽ hơn( tăng khoảng cách thu vạc )),nhằm tinh chỉnh cho nhỏ led mặt trời DI vạc chuỗi xung năng lượng điện nàỵ thành chuỗi tia nắng hồng ngoại (tương ứng cùng với chuỗi điện áp trên) thông qua không khí đến ỈC thu hồng ngoại trên mạch thu.Để IC PT2248 của mạch phát lảm việc được cần phải có bộ tạo xấp xỉ gồm thạch anh 455Khz với hai tụ 121p C2 với C3.• Sơ đồ vật phần thu

*

Từ IC thu hồng ngoại PIC – 1018 khi nhận thấy chuỗi ánh nắng hồng ngoại từ mạch phát cho thì IC PIC – 1018 sẽ gửi thành chuỗi biểu lộ điện giới thiệu chân 1 (do chuỗi biểu hiện điện từ chân 1 của IC PIC – 1018 là ngược chuỗi biểu thị điện tại ngõ ra của IC PT2248 bên trên mạch phát: chân 15 bên trên IC PT2248 tất cả mức xúc tích và ngắn gọn 1 thì ngõ ra bên trên chân số 1 của IC PIC – 1018 lại là mức logic 0).Để có thể khôi phục lại đúng với chuỗi biểu lộ như lúc đầu thì trường đoản cú chân 2IC PIC – 1018 rất cần được có mạch đảo chuỗi biểu lộ lại, trải qua transistor q1 (D468), tìn hiệu được lấy ra từ rất c. Tại phía trên chuỗi biểu đạt đã được phục sinh và khuếch tán lên đúng với chuỗi tín hiệu ban đầu, tiếp đến được chuyển vào chân số 2 (Rxin) của IC PT2249 để tinh chỉnh mạch chấp hành.Từ IC PT2249 trên mạch thu khi nhận được tín hiệu tương xứng với phím số 1 trên mạch phát, IC PT2249 sẽ điều khiển chân số 3 (Hl) lên mức xúc tích 1 đưa vào IC 74LS14 để đảo thành nút 0 và những tín hiệu ra từ chân 4-8 tương tự như chân 3.• Sơ đồ mạch điều khiển và tinh chỉnh và hiển thị

*

Các biểu hiện ở ngõ ra của IC PT2249 sau thời điểm đưa qua IC 74LS14 nhằm đào tín hiệu được gửi vào Port 3 của vi tinh chỉnh (PO.O – P0.5) để xử lý những tín hiệu này. Sáu tín hiệu này gồm: START, STOP, SET, MODE, UP, DOWN để điều khiển và thiết lập thời gian nhằm hẹn giờ tắt thiết bị. Thời gian setup được hiển thị lên 4 led 7 đoạn ( 2 led hiển thị phút cùng 2 led hiển thị giây). Sau thời điểm thời gian thiết đặt được cho đến khi hết thì vi điều khiển xuất biểu đạt ra chân P1.7 để điều khiển và tinh chỉnh ngắt relay.START: tín hiệu cho phép khởi rượu cồn thiết bỉ.STOP: biểu hiện cho phép hoàn thành thiết bị.MODE: tín hiệu lực chọn đề con led (led đơn vị hoặc 2 led phút) để thiết lập thờigian.UP: tín hiệu được cho phép tăng thời gian cài đặt.DOWN: tín hiệu chất nhận được giảm thời gian cài đặtSET: tín hiệu chất nhận được thời gian tải đặt ban đầu đếm ngược.

3. Thiết kế Và xây dựng Mạch

3.1 Sơ Đồ Mạch In Và linh phụ kiện Sử Dụng

3.1.1 Mạch in mạch phát biểu lộ hồng – linh phụ kiện sử dụng vào mạch: ngoại:

*

STTTên linh kiệnGiá trịSỐ lượng
1.Điện trở RI10K1
2.Tụ gốm (C27c3)121p2
3.Tụ hóa47 ụ.1
4.Transistor:

Q1

02

D468

A1013

1

1

5.Diode1N41482
6.Led phạt hồng ngoại1
7.Nút nhấn6
8.ICPT22481
9.Thạch anh455Khz1
*

STTTên linh kiệnGiá trịSố lượng
1.Điện trở: R1,R439k2
R23k31
R3330R1
R5100R1
2.

Xem thêm: Cách Phối Đồ Màu Đỏ Cho Nam Nam Ấn Tượng, Độc Đ Áo Đỏ Mặc Với Quần Màu Gì Nam

Tụ

C1,C3

47*12
C2102p1
3.IC71LS141
ICPT22491
4.Transistor:

Q1

D4681
5.Led thu hồng ngoạiPIC-1018SCL1
6.Led báo nguồn1
7.Giắc cắm hàng rào1
3.1.3 Mạch In Mạch giải pháp xử lý Tín Hiện cùng Điều Khiển Thiết Bị

*

STTTên linh kiệnGiá trịSố lượng
LĐiện trở:
Rl, R15 -R18lOk5
R6L5k1
R7-R14330R8
2.Tụ:
CÌ,C747fi2
C4,C533p2
C60.1 li1
3.IC 78051
4.ICAT89S521
5.Transistor:

Q2-Q5

Q7

Q6

A1015

A1013

D468

4

1

1

6.Led 7 đoạn: Led 7 thường1
Led 7 mini1
7.Nút nhấn1
8.Relay 5V1
9.Giắc gặm cái1
Giắc cắn hàng rào1
10.Thạch anh12Mhz1
Code trả Chỉnh

BDNEQUR1
DVEQUR2
CHUCEQUR3
MAMODEQUR4
GIAYEQUR5
STARTBITP3.0
MODEBITP3.1
UPBITP3.2
DNBITP3.3
STBBITP3.4
STOPBITP3.5
ORG 0000H
JMP MAIN
ORG 000BH

CALL HIENTHI5 MOV TH0,#HIGH(-5000) MOV TLO,#LOW( 5000) RETI

ORG 001BH inc BDN

MOV THI ,#HIGH(-50000) MOV TL1 ,#LOW( 50000) RETI

MAIN:MOV DPTR,#MA7DOAN MOV TMOD,#llH MOV IE,#10001010B

LB: MOV 28H,#07FH

MOV 29H,#0FFH MOV 2AH,#0FFH

P1.7

START,$

DELAY10MS

START,$

DELAY10MS

P1.7

MAMOD,#00

30H,#0BFH

31H,#0BFH

32H,#0BFH

33H,#0BFH

CHUC,#00

DV,#00

GIAY,#00

TRO ;// NGAT HIEN THI

STOP,LB6

P0.7

TRO

CLR TRI JMP LB

LB6: JNB MODE,CH_MODE CJNE MAMOD,#01,KEYC1 JMP C_DV KEYC1:

CJNE MAMOD,#02,KEYC2 JMP C_CHUC KEYC2: JMP LB1

CH_MODE:

CALL DELAY1MS JB MODE,KEYCl hotline DELAY1MS JB MODE.KEYCl inc MAMOD CJNE MAMOD,#03,CH_M 1 MOV MAMOD,#00 CH_M1:

CALL XOAY_DC hotline GIAIMA_DC CH_M2:

JNB MODE,CH_M2 JMP LB1

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x C_DV: JB UP,CH_DV_DN điện thoại tư vấn DELAY1MS JB UP,CH_DV_DN call DELAY1MS inh DV

CJNE DV,#10,CH_DV2 MOV DV,#00 CH_DV2:

CALL GIAIMA_DC CH_DV1:

JNB UP,CH_DV1

JMP LB1

CH_DV_DN:

JB DN,STG call DELAY1MS JB DN,STG điện thoại tư vấn DELAY1MS DEC DV

CJNE DV,#-1 ,CH_DV3 MOV DV,#9 CH_DV3:

CALL GIAIMA_DC CH_DV4:

JNB DN,CH_DV4 JMP LB1

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x

C_CHUC:

JB UP,CH_CHUC_DN gọi DELAY1MS JB UP,CH_CHUC_DN hotline DELAY1MS inh CHUC

ONE CHUC,#10,CH_CHUC2 MOV CHUC,#00 CH_CHUC2:

CALL GIAIMA_DC CH_CHUC1:

JNB UP,CH_CHUC1 JMP LB1

CH_CHUC_DN:

JB DN,STG call DELAY1MS JB DN,STG call DELAY1MS DEC CHUC

CJNECHUC,#-1 ,CH_CHUC3
MOVCHUC,#9
CH_CHUC3:
CALL GIAIMA_DC
CH_CHUC4:
JNBDN,CH_CHUC4
K:JMPLB1
;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
STG:JBSTB,K
CALLDELAY1MS
JBSTB,K
CALLDELAY1MS
MOVA,DV
ADDACHUC
CJNEA,#00,LB 11
CALLXOAY_DCl
JMPLB 18
LB11:CALLXOAY_DCl
SETBTR1
ONEDV,#00,LB 17
DECCHUC
LB5:MOVDV,#9
LB4:MOVGIAY,#59
LB3:CALLGIAIMA_DC
LB7:CJNEBDN,#20,$+3
JCLB2
MOVBDN,#00
DECGIAY
ONEGIAY,#-1,LB3
DECDV
CJNEDV,#-1,LB4
DECCHUC
CJNECHUC,#-1,LB5
SETBPI .7
CLRTRO
CLRTR1
JMPLB

LB17: DEC DV JMP LB4

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x LB2: JB STOP,LB10 SETB P1.7 CLR TRO CLR TRI JMP LB

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x LB10: JNB MODE,CH_MODEl CJNE MAMOD,#01,KEYC3 JMP C_DV1

KEYC3: CJNE MAMOD,#02,KEYC4

JMP C_CHƯC1 KEYC4: JMP LB7

CH_MODEl:

CLR TRI gọi DELAY1MS JB MODE,KEYC3 gọi DELAY1MS JB MODE.KEYC3 inch MAMOD CJNE MAMOD,#03,CH_M3 MOV MAMOD,#00 CH_M3: gọi XOAY_DC

CALL GIAIMA_DC CH_M4: JNB MODE,CH_M4

JMP LB7

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x

C_DV1:

JB UP,CH_DV_DN1 điện thoại tư vấn DELAY1MS JB UP,CH_D V_DN 1

CALL DELAY1MS inh DV

CJNE DV,#10,CH_DV6

MOV DV,#00 CH_DV6:

CALL GIAIMA_DC CH_DV5:

JNB UP,CH_DV5 JMP LB7

CH_DV_DN1:

JB DN,LP1 điện thoại tư vấn DELAY1MS JB DN,LP1 điện thoại tư vấn DELAY1MS DEC DV

CJNE DV,#-1 ,CH_DV7 MOV DV,#9 CH_DV7:

CALL GIAIMA_DC CH_DV8:

JNB DN,CH_DV8 JMP LB7 LP1: JMP STG RET

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x

C_CHƯC1:

JB UP,CH_CHUC_DN 1

CALL DELAY1MS JB UP,CH_CHUC_DN1 điện thoại tư vấn DELAY1MS inc CHUC

CJNE CHUC,#10,CH_CHUC6 MOV CHUC,#00 CH_CHUC6:

CALL GIAIMA_DC CH_CHUC5:

JNB UP,CH_CHUC5 JMP LB7

CH_CHUC_DN 1:

JB DN,LP1 gọi DELAY1MS JB DN,LP1 call DELAY1MS DEC CHUC

CJNE CHUC,#-1 ,CH_CHUC7 MOV CHUC,#9 CH_CHUC7:

CALL GIAIMA_DC CH_CHUC8:

JNB DN,CH_CHUC8 JMP LB7

;x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x

XOAY_DCl:

CJNE MAMOD,#01 ,LB 13 MOV 35H,#02 LB14: gọi XOAY_DC DJNZ 35H,LB14 MOV MAMOD,#00 RET